Social Worker II
Your Opportunity:
The Social Worker II is an essential member of the integrated recovery-orientated team that works in collaboration with individuals within our correctional health services centers and external stakeholders to facilitate transition into the community. The candidate will be a highly motivated, confident, and dependable individual who collaborates with team members, patients and their families in a fast-paced environment ensuring trauma-informed, equitable care. The candidate will hold working knowledge of health care systems and community resources to support psychosocial interventions such as crisis intervention, resource navigation, advocacy, and referring to internal/external agencies. As a Social Worker II you are part of a team dedicated to providing quality patient centered care through best practices and evidence informed approaches, aligning with social work Code of Ethics.
Description:
As a Social Worker II, you will be a member of an inter-disciplinary team and provides a range of social work services to patients and their families. Your services may include: psychosocial assessment, resource-based interventions, individual, group and family treatment, risk screening, counselling, case management and coordination, transition or discharge planning, and prevention, promotion and public awareness activities.
